如果您愿意,您可以强制adduser和addgroup分别在创建用户和组时分配特定的用户和组IDs。可以通过使用--uid和 --gid选项来实现。--uid IDForce the new userid to be the given number. adduser will fail if the userid is already taken. 强制新用户使用给定的编号。如果编号已经存在,则命令会失败...
useradd -s /bin/sh -g group -G adm,root sam:创建一个登录用户sam,该用户登录的shell为/bin/sh,属于group用户组,同时属于用户组adm与root,但group是其主组 userdel 删除用户账号 -r:最常用的一个选项,用户的主目录被一起删除 例如: userdel -r sam:删除sam在文件系统中(/etc/password、/etc/shadow、...
例如,root用户属于root组,拥有完整的系统权限,而普通用户通常属于regular组,权限相对较小。 将用户添加到组 要在FreeBSD中添加用户到组,可以使用命令"freebsd add user to group"。例如,要将用户user添加到group group1,可以使用以下命令: freebsd add user togroupuser group1 在这个命令中,"add"是动词,表示添...
-n新用户组 将用户组的名字改为新名字groupmod –g 10000 -n group3 group2 # 此命令组group2的标识号改为10000,组名修改为group3 切换用户组newgrp,以便具有其他用户组的权限 newgrp root# 这条命令将当前用户切换到root用户组,前提条件是root用户组确实是该用户的主组或附加组 与用户账号有关的系统文件 这...
1,在root权限下,useradd只是创建了一个用户名,如 (useradd +用户名 ),它并没有在/home目录下创建同名文件夹,也没有创建密码,因此利用这个用户登录系统,是登录不了的,为了避免这样的情况出现,可以用 (useradd -m +用户名)的方式创建,它会在/home目录下创建同名文件夹,然后利用( passwd + 用户名)为指定的...
使用useradd创建一个名为newuser的用户,并将其加入 root 用户组。 使用adduser命令将newuser加入到 sudo 用户组,确保它可以执行 sudo 命令。 关系图 为了更好地理解 Docker 用户管理的关系,以下是 Docker 中用户、用户组与权限关系的 ER 图。 USERstringusernamestringpasswordGROUPstringgroupnameUSER_GROUPstringuser...
#useradd-s /bin/sh -g group –G adm,root gem 此命令新建了一个用户gem,该用户的登录Shell是/bin/sh,它属于group用户组,同时又属于adm和root用户组,其中group用户组是其主组。 这里可能新建组: #groupaddgroup 及groupaddadm 增加用户账号就是在/etc/passwd文件中为新用户增加一条记录,同时更新其他系统文件...
useradd -G {group-name} username In this example, create a new user called vivek and add it to group called developers. First login as a root user (make sure group developers exists), enter: # grep developers /etc/group Output:
使用sudo:非 root 用户需要通过sudo来执行useradd命令,这要求该用户具有执行此操作的 sudo 权限。 总之,useradd是 Linux 下一个非常基础且强大的命令,通过熟悉其参数和选项,可以灵活地管理系统中的用户账户。然而,在使用时也要注意合理规划 UID、GID 和主目录等信息,并关注安全性问题。
1. 打开终端,以root用户身份登录系统。 2. 使用以下命令创建新用户: “` useradd [选项] 用户名 “` 其中,[选项]可以根据需要选择,用户名为要创建的新用户的名称。 3. 设置用户密码,使用以下命令: “` passwd 用户名 “` 系统会提示输入新用户的密码,按照提示输入两次密码即可完成密码设置。